Congratulations on a good hunt. From what I have found out over the years your pipe bowl is considered a newer style trade pipe. It used a reed or hollow wooden stem. They were made primarily beginning in 1878 and production stopped by 1951. I found one complete with wooden stem in a crawl space under a school built in 1922. They are a neat find.
